Servidor HTTP (WEB)
Un servidor web o servidor HTTP es un programa informático que procesa una aplicación del lado del servidor, realizando conexiones bidireccionales y/o unidireccionales y síncronas o asíncronas con el cliente y generando o cediendo una respuesta en cualquier lenguaje o Aplicación del lado del cliente.
Uno de los servidores http mas utilizados es el apache. Para la instalacion de este simplemente ejecutamos el siguiente comando despues de actualizar los repositorios.
- Luego en la ruta cd /var/www/html podemos publicar nuestras paginas html que queramos mostrar.
Para comprobar que se ha publicado desde nuestro navegador buscamos nuestra pagina con el nombre de dominio especificado de la siguiente manera:
- Para modificar el directorio raíz de apache es necesario modificar el archivo /etc/apache2/sites-available/000-default.conf
Donde modificamos la linea DocumentRoot por la ruta donde se encuentra el directorio que queremos que sea el nuevo raiz.
- Para modificar el puerto de apache modificamos el archivo ports.conf ubicado en /etc/apache2 modificando la linea listen y le colocamos el nuevo puerto que queremos asignar de la siguiente manera:
- Después es necesario modificar nuevamente el archivo /etc/apache2/sites-available/000-default.conf de la siguiente manera